CNY rush: Slow traffic on major highways on Feb 12 afternoon


KUALA LUMPUR: Traffic flow on several major highways was reported to be slow-moving as of 1pm on Monday (Feb 12) as travellers began their journey back to their respective destinations after the Chinese New Year festive holiday.

A spokesperson from the Malaysian Highway Authority said that southbound traffic was moving slowly from Gopeng to Tapah and from Kuala Kangsar to the Meru tunnel in Perak.
